I needed a new French and Spanish atlas and was unsure whether it was worth paying the extra for the French laminated one. I decided to go for it and I must say I am really impressed with it, very robust and easy to draw routes on and then rub out. I just wish the Spanish one was available as laminated. If you are considering getting a laminated one I can highly recommend paying the extra. (y)

We have the laminated one and it's great. Marked the intended route with dry board marker each day. We also have the Michelin one for Spain and Portugal and agree it's flimsy compared to the France one. It also is less detailed as scale appears different.
